Former Steps chef opens new restaurant at Rosario

Madden Surbaugh, formerly of Steps Wine Bar & Grill in Friday Harbor, is opening The Quilted Pig in the waterfront veranda of the Moran Mansion at Rosario Resort.

The resort reopens Friday with the new restaurant, a refurbished spa, and guest accommodations. The Barto family of Anacortes purchased the 30-acre resort in 2008 from Olympus Real Estate Partners.

While chef/owner of Steps, Surbaugh was voted one of the “Northwest’s Best Chefs” by KCTS Channel 9 public television in 2008 and was awarded Wine Enthusiast magazine’s Award of Unique Distinction. He created the Islands Certified Local program and is a member of the board of the San Juan Agricultural Guild.
